Oman - Oil Refinery Capacities

Since 2014, Oman Oil Refinery Capacities was up 8.5% year on year. At 334 Thousand Barrels Per Day in 2019, the country was ranked number 45 among other countries in Oil Refinery Capacities. Oman is overtaken by Norway, which was number 44 at 342 Thousand Barrels Per Day and is followed by Portugal with 330 Thousand Barrels Per Day. United States lead the ranking with 18,974 Thousand Barrels Per Day in 2019, that is a growth of 1.1% compared to 2018. China, Russia and India resp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Vietnam witnessed the best average annual growth at +18.2% per year, while Trinidad and Tobago was the worst growing country at -100% per year.
